Songpa-gu is home to several noteworthy attractions that highlight both modern and traditional aspects of Seoul. One of the most popular sites is Lotte World, an extensive amusement park that includes both indoor and outdoor attractions, along with shopping and dining options. Additionally, the beautiful Olympic Park, which hosted the 1988 Summer Olympics, offers scenic walking trails, beautiful landscapes, and historical monuments. For those interested in history, the Seokchon Lake area provides a picturesque spot adorned with cherry blossoms in spring and is adjacent to the ancient Songpa Naru Park.

Songpa-gu is conveniently situated with excellent public transportation options, making it easy for visitors to explore other parts of Seoul. The area is serviced by multiple subway lines, including Line 2 and Line 5, which connect to key areas such as Gangnam, Myeongdong, and Hongdae. Buses also frequently run through the district, offering access to various neighborhoods. For those preferring to travel by taxi or ride-sharing services, getting around is both affordable and convenient, allowing for smooth travel throughout the city.
